Birmingham, AL: Palladium Press (1998) 500 pp. Original dark blue leather covers w/ gilt decoration on binding. Gilt title and four raised bands on spine. Binding very bright and clean. All edges gilt w/ brown moire endpapers. Illust. w/ b/w photos. Contents very nice.. Hard Cover. Fine/No Dust Jacket.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
